- Microsoft's client revenue skids; Blame netbooks, Windows 7 deferrals
- Microsoft's fourth quarter earnings were better than expectations excluding items, but the software giant's client Windows revenue skidded 29 percent compared to a year ago. For the three months ended June 30, Microsoft's client revenue was $3.1 billion, down from $4.36 billion a year ago. That slide in Windows revenue...
